AI Snapshot

Taggbox is a SaaS-based user-generated content (UGC) platform in the marketing and advertising category. It enables brands to collect, curate, and showcase customer-created content through social widgets, review widgets, and social walls. The platform is designed to help brands leverage social proof, with claimed improvements of up to 30% in both engagement and conversions. Taggbox serves brands and event organizers seeking to integrate UGC into websites and live events.

What products or services does Taggbox offer?

Taggbox offers an all-in-one UGC platform comprising three main product categories: social widgets, which display aggregated social media content on websites; review widgets, which showcase customer reviews as social proof; and social walls, which are real-time displays of user-generated content used particularly at events and on websites. Together, these products are designed to help brands collect, curate, and present customer content to drive engagement and conversions.
